Call me cynical, but I tend to take PR statements such as "positive dialogue continues with a number of other airlines" with a pinch of salt. The form of words may vary to give the impression of imminent progress, but all an airport business is really saying is that they employ a route development team who continue to do the job they are paid to do 24/7/365. Dependent on their own marketing skills, the strength of the proposition they have to sell, and economic conditions, they will either enjoy some success (or not). But they will pursue dialogue with airlines over many years regardless. Some such long-term relationships will eventually bear fruit (eg. Cathay Pacific at Manchester); others will not, no matter how persuasive the pitch may seem (eg. Wizz Air - stubbornly still not at Manchester). Ultimately, the airlines hold the whip-hand. They are not short of suitors; they can pick and choose.

And aside from a deal on fees and some marketing help, there is surprisingly little an airport can offer in the context of a new service. For example, if a Chinese carrier were to consider a new service to Shanghai from either MAN, BHX, GLA or EDI, what can an airport really do to swing the outcome their way? Even if one of them offered zero charges plus marketing support, what percentage of overall operating costs does the use of one (of two) airports represent (after fuel, maintenance, staff wages, depreciation, insurance, nav charges, lease / purchase fees etc., etc.?). The answer is not very much at all. And all airports bidding for new business will make attractive offers of their own anyway. And they still have to pay their own way as a business. They can't offer their services for free (unless willing to do likewise for all their other airline customers). And how would that work out?

So the primary skill required is the ability to effectively market the catchment / hinterland of your subject airport. How large is the potential market? How wealthy is it? How great is the propensity to travel? Are there synergies or potential synergies between industries at either end of the route? How strong is access to connecting flights? Are the destinations at either end of the route likely to attract tourism flows in high volume? Answering questions such as these positively will secure the best chance of a successful outcome.

You can employ the finest route negotiator in the world, authorised to offer fee-free access and marketing incentives, to pitch services to a remote mid-Atlantic island to Chinese long-haul carriers. That executive will still fail. But effectively communicate the advantages of an airport which offers a strong economic proposition - even one charging reasonable fees (because it too is a business with financial commitments) - and a mutually acceptable deal can be agreed. An airline won't turn down a fee-free regime or a discount - they will likely negotiate for incentives - but the airport's market proposition will be the ultimate clincher.

My post has drifted rather from MAG's post-Monarch statement above. But still, the point stands that a major airport is always in a position to state that it 'continues in dialogue' with potential airline customers. I'd expect no less at any time, but it doesn't imply any guarantee of a successful outcome in the near term. We'll just have to keep our fingers crossed for that.

The 2017 CAA annual statistics are out.

Some general highlights..

There are some 266 airports showing as having at least 1 passenger routing to/from MAN
There are some 222 airports showing as having at least 1 passenger routing to/from MAN on a scheduled service
There are some 111 airports showing as having no charter passengers but at least 1 scheduled service passenger
There are some 47 airports showing as having no scheduled service passengers but at least 1 charter passenger
There are some 31 airports showing with no passengers recorded compared to 2016

There is just 1 route showing with 1 million passengers... Amsterdam with 1,041,792 passengers, of which 1,041,430 were on scheduled services and 362 were on charter services.
Potentially we could see 3 routes with 1 million passengers this year as the following 2 routes are nearly there:
Dubai with 990,269 passengers (all of which were on scheduled services)
Dublin with 974,979 passengers of which 973,472 were on scheduled service and 1,507 on charter services

The route with fewest passengers was Bogota with the princely total of 1 on a scheduled service!
The route with the biggest increase in percentage terms was San Francisco which was up 23,600%
Excluding the 0 passenger routes, the route with the largest fall in percentage terms was Genoa which was down 98.27%


The route with the biggest increase in passenger numbers was Hamburg which gained 130,651 passengers.
The route with the largest fall in passenger numbers was Rygge which was down 53,785 passengers to 0. Of those recording a passenger number in 2017, the biggest loser was Istanbul which was down 40,748 passengers


In terms of scheduled services, it was Hamburg for the biggest increase and Rygge/Istanbul for the biggest losers.
In terms of charter services, the biggest increase was to Las Palmas and the biggest losers were Cancun and Hurghada (conversion of some flights to scheduled service as overall numbers increased) with Palma being the candidate for one not primarily affected by conversion of services.

As the financial year comes to a close, the UK’s third biggest airport, Manchester, unveils the most popular long-haul routes chosen by its 27.8m passengers across its extensive catchment area.

With 22m people in its catchment that spans north to Scotland, south to the Midlands, west to Merseyside and Wales, and east To Yorkshire, the data released today highlights how the global gateway connects millions of people to a wealth of economic hubs and tourist destinations.

Orlando marks the most popular destination by far across the entire catchment area with more than 500,000 passengers each year, but each county has an interesting set of routes its inhabitants jet off to each year. As well as offering passengers’ holidays, a lot of the routes are actually key for business and trade opportunities. For example, Houston is a top destination in Scotland due to the oil and gas links, whereas San Francisco offers a vital connection to the vibrant tech cities of Leeds and Manchester.

In recent years Manchester Airport has added numerous long-haul routes to its network that in the UK, can only be found at the Northern hub, or in London. These include Beijing, San Francisco, Boston, Muscat, Houston and Hong Kong to name a few.

It is for this reason why the airport pulls in so many passengers from a vast area as people want to fly direct rather than hubbing through other airports or travelling down to the congested capital.

Many of these routes are providing vital connectivity to international markets for key sectors like tech, life sciences, energy and advanced manufacturing.

Manchester Airport’s long-haul routes are also bringing hundreds of thousands of international tourists to the North and beyond each year, providing a boost to hotels, restaurants and visitor attractions.

The chart accompanying the article above is very interesting as a standalone graphic. But the manner in which it has been paired up with the narrative issued by the PR people without further explanation makes it highly misleading. I can understand the interest in long-haul catchments. But what that chart is actually showing is the distribution of bookings for all routes to / from MAN. If you add up those regional totals you get a figure which is close to the airport's entire annual throughput. There is of course a small shortfall representing outliers who originate in regions not featured on the chart. So, for example, those 1.4M pax shown for the West Midlands region are actually spread across MAN's entire network, not long-haul routes in isolation. It would have been helpful had the authors of the article spelled-out that distinction more clearly.

If I've counted correctly, the figures for the regions add up to 25.75m, about 2m short of the 2017 pax statistics but much closer to 2016. However, a couple of points occur.

How have they dealt with pax that are not UK originating?
80/20 ratio used to be quoted but even if the percentage of pax originating abroad is say 15%, it still represents 4m in total. If, for example, an Indian visits relatives in Yorkshire, or an Australian friends in Wales, do they count the return as the origin?

Secondly, there are transfer pax. I don't know how relevant the figure would be in thee wider context but it's been mentioned several times that a decent number of folk fly from Ireland to MAN to catch the VS service to Orlando. Other transfers have been said to include Germans coming to MAN to catch TCX flights, and there are some Scandinavians transferring at MAN apparently.

Nevertheless, as EGCC_MAN comments, the initial map showing the demographics of MAN's passenger profile by UK region is certainly of interest, assuming it's reasonably accurate.
That number travelling over the Pennines from Yorkshire is of particular significance within MAN's total and I can appreciate is a sore point among some contributors from that county on the various forums.
